@@ -694,7 +699,17 @@ bool AddressSanitizer::handleFunction(Module &M, Function &F) {
   DEBUG(dbgs() << F);
 
   bool ChangedStack = poisonStackInFunction(M, F);
-  return NumInstrumented > 0 || ChangedStack;
+
+  // We must unpoison the stack before every NoReturn call (throw, _exit, etc).
+  // See e.g. http://code.google.com/p/address-sanitizer/issues/detail?id=37
+  for (size_t i = 0, n = NoReturnCalls.size(); i != n; i++) {
+    Instruction *CI = NoReturnCalls[i];
+    IRBuilder<> IRB(CI);
+    IRB.CreateCall(M.getOrInsertFunction(kAsanHandleNoReturnName,
+                                         IRB.getVoidTy(), NULL));
+  }
+
+  return NumInstrumented > 0 || ChangedStack || !NoReturnCalls.empty();
 }
